Curtis Blues is an educator and talented musician who plays multiple instruments. With his performances helping keep the tradition of acoustic American roots music alive, Curtis demonstrates for students the origins of modern rock and hip-hop music. He has recorded three critically acclaimed CDs and performs at Blues festivals and schools in an effort to pass this music down to the next generation.
